如何制定精准的网站搭建预算:从需求分析到成本控制全流程实践指南

在开始构建网站之前,明确预算范围是至关重要的第一步。无论是个人博客、企业官网还是复杂的电商平台,不合理的预算规划都可能导致项目延期、超支或最终效果不达预期。本文将深入探讨如何根据实际需求,制定出既符合预期又具有成本效益的网站搭建预算,涵盖从需求分析到成本控制的每一个关键环节。

网站搭建预算的核心构成要素

网站搭建成本并非单一数字,而是由多个相互关联的组成部分构成。理解这些核心要素,是进行精准预算规划的基础。

如何制定精准的网站搭建预算:从需求分析到成本控制全流程实践指南

1. 需求分析:预算的起点

在投入任何资金之前,必须对网站的目标、功能、用户群体和预期效果进行深入分析。这包括:

  • 网站类型与定位:企业官网、电子商务、内容分享、社区论坛等。
  • 核心功能需求:用户注册、购物车、支付系统、内容管理系统(CMS)、SEO优化等。
  • 技术要求:响应式设计、移动端适配、特定开发框架(如React、Vue)、安全性需求等。
  • 内容规模:页面数量、图片数量、视频需求、文案撰写等。

一个详尽的需求文档不仅能指导开发团队,更是预算规划的依据。例如,一个需要复杂支付系统的电子商务网站,其开发成本将远高于简单的信息展示型网站。

2. 设计与开发成本

这是网站搭建预算中最主要的组成部分,包括:

  • UI/UX设计:原型设计、视觉设计、交互设计等。
  • 前端开发:、CSS、JavaScript实现,响应式布局,跨浏览器兼容性等。
  • 后端开发:服务器端语言(PHP、Python、Node.js等)、数据库设计、API开发等。
  • CMS集成:如果使用WordPress、Drupal等CMS系统,需要考虑主题定制、插件开发等。
  • 第三方服务集成:支付网关、地图服务、社交媒体登录等。

开发成本受多种因素影响,包括开发人员的经验水平、开发周期、技术复杂度等。一般来说,初级开发人员的小时费率可能在50-100元人民币/小时,而经验丰富的专家可能达到300-1000元人民币/小时不等。

3. 托管与维护成本

网站上线后仍需持续投入,主要包括:

  • 服务器托管:共享主机、VPS、独立服务器等,费用从每月几十元到数千元不等。
  • 域名注册与续费:每年几百元人民币。
  • SSL证书:确保网站安全,费用从免费到数千元不等。
  • 日常维护:系统更新、安全监控、数据备份、性能优化等。
  • 技术支持:如果需要专业团队提供7x24小时支持,成本会显著增加。

4. 推广与营销成本

即使网站开发完成,也需要投入资源吸引用户。这包括:

  • SEO优化:关键词研究、网站结构优化、内容优化等。
  • SEM广告:搜索引擎广告投放。
  • 社交媒体营销:内容创作、社群运营等。
  • 内容营销:博客文章、视频制作等。
  • 邮件营销:用户列表构建、邮件模板设计等。

推广成本因策略和渠道而异,部分成功的SEO项目可能只需少量投入,而大规模的付费广告可能需要每月数千甚至数万元人民币。

5. 其他潜在成本

在制定预算时,还应考虑以下因素:

  • 第三方插件/工具:如邮件营销工具、CRM系统等。
  • 内容创作:专业文案、图片设计、视频制作等。
  • 法律合规:隐私政策、服务条款、版权处理等。
  • 意外开销:预留10%-20%的应急资金。

实践步骤:制定网站搭建预算的具体方法

接下来,我们将通过一个实际案例,演示如何制定网站搭建预算。假设我们需要构建一个中等规模的企业官网,功能包括:首页、关于我们、产品展示、新闻中心、联系我们、在线咨询等。

1. 需求细化与功能清单

首先,将网站需求转化为具体的功能清单:

功能模块 具体需求
首页 轮播图、公司简介、产品分类、新闻快讯、联系方式
关于我们 公司历史、团队介绍、企业文化、资质荣誉
产品展示 产品列表、详情页、规格参数、用户评价、相关推荐
新闻中心 文章列表、详情页、分类筛选、标签云、评论系统
联系我们 联系表单、地图展示、客服电话、社交媒体链接
在线咨询 实时聊天窗口、常见问题解答、预约服务

2. 设计与开发成本估算

根据功能清单,估算设计与开发成本:

UI/UX设计

设计阶段包括原型设计、视觉设计和交互设计。对于中等规模的企业官网,建议采用定制化设计,以体现品牌特色。

language-bash
 设计成本估算
 原型设计:2人天 × 800元/人天 = 1,600元
 视觉设计:4人天 × 1,200元/人天 = 4,800元
 交互设计:2人天 × 1,000元/人天 = 2,000元
 总计:8,400元

设计费用受设计师资历和设计复杂度影响。初级设计师的费用可能在500-800元人民币/人天,而资深设计师或设计团队可能达到1500-3000元人民币/人天。

前端开发

前端开发包括、CSS、JavaScript实现,响应式布局,跨浏览器兼容性等。对于中等规模的企业官网,建议使用现代前端框架(如React或Vue)以提高开发效率和用户体验。

language-bash
 前端开发成本估算
 前端开发:6人天 × 800元/人天 = 4,800元
 响应式设计:2人天 × 800元/人天 = 1,600元
 跨浏览器测试:2人天 × 600元/人天 = 1,200元
 总计:7,600元

前端开发费用受开发人员经验、技术复杂度和开发周期影响。一般来说,前端开发人员的费用可能在600-1200元人民币/人天。

后端开发

后端开发包括服务器端语言(如PHP或Node.js)、数据库设计、API开发等。对于企业官网,建议使用成熟稳定的后端架构,以保障系统性能和安全性。

language-bash
 后端开发成本估算
 后端开发:8人天 × 1000元/人天 = 8,000元
 数据库设计与开发:2人天 × 1000元/人天 = 2,000元
 API开发:4人天 × 1000元/人天 = 4,000元
 总计:14,000元

后端开发费用受开发人员经验、技术复杂度和开发周期影响。一般来说,后端开发人员的费用可能在800-1500元人民币/人天。

CMS集成

如果选择使用WordPress作为CMS系统,需要考虑主题定制和插件开发。对于企业官网,建议选择可定制的商业主题,并开发必要的自定义插件。

language-bash
 CMS集成成本估算
 主题定制:2人天 × 800元/人天 = 1,600元
 插件开发:4人天 × 800元/人天 = 3,200元
 总计:4,800元

CMS集成费用受主题选择、插件复杂度和开发工作量影响。商业主题的费用可能在数千元到数万元不等,而插件开发费用可能在500-2000元人民币/人天。

3. 托管与维护成本估算

根据网站规模和功能需求,选择合适的托管方案:

服务器托管

对于中等规模的企业官网,建议使用高性能的VPS或共享主机。VPS的费用通常在每月300-1000元人民币,共享主机的费用可能在每月100-500元人民币。

language-bash
 服务器托管成本估算
 VPS托管:每月500元 × 12个月 = 6,000元
 域名注册与续费:每年500元 × 3年 = 1,500元
 SSL证书:1,000元(购买1年)
 总计:7,500元

托管费用受服务器配置、带宽需求和托管服务商影响。一般来说,VPS的费用可能在300-1000元人民币/月,共享主机的费用可能在100-500元人民币/月。

日常维护

日常维护包括系统更新、安全监控、数据备份、性能优化等。建议每月投入一定预算用于维护工作。

language-bash
 日常维护成本估算
 每月维护:500元 × 12个月 = 6,000元
 总计:6,000元

日常维护费用受维护工作量、技术复杂度和维护团队经验影响。一般来说,网站维护费用可能在300-1000元人民币/月。

4. 推广与营销成本估算

为了确保网站能够吸引目标用户,需要投入一定的推广资源:

SEO优化

SEO优化包括关键词研究、网站结构优化、内容优化等。建议进行全面的SEO策略规划,以提高网站的自然搜索排名。

language-bash
 SEO优化成本估算
 关键词研究:1人天 × 800元/人天 = 800元
 网站结构优化:2人天 × 800元/人天 = 1,600元
 内容优化:4人天 × 600元/人天 = 2,400元
 总计:4,800元

SEO优化费用受优化工作量、关键词竞争度和优化团队经验影响。一般来说,SEO优化的费用可能在1000-5000元人民币。

SEM广告

如果需要快速提升网站流量,可以考虑投放SEM广告。建议根据实际效果调整广告预算。

language-bash
 SEM广告成本估算
 每月预算:2,000元 × 6个月 = 12,000元
 总计:12,000元

SEM广告费用受广告竞争度、关键词选择和广告投放策略影响。一般来说,SEM广告的每日预算可能在1000-5000元人民币。

5. 其他潜在成本估算

除了上述主要成本外,还应考虑以下潜在费用:

language-bash
 其他潜在成本估算
 内容创作:文案撰写、图片设计等,总计:3,000元
 法律合规:隐私政策、服务条款等,总计:1,000元
 应急资金:总预算的10%,总计:23,000元 × 10% = 2,300元
 总计:6,300元

这些潜在费用应根据实际情况进行调整,以确保预算的全面性。

6. 总预算汇总

将所有成本汇总,得到网站搭建的总预算:

成本项目 估算金额(元)
UI/UX设计 8,400
前端开发 7,600
后端开发 14,000
CMS集成 4,800
服务器托管 6,000
域名注册与续费 1,500
SSL证书 1,000
日常维护 6,000
SEO优化 4,800
SEM广告 12,000
内容创作 3,000
法律合规 1,000
应急资金 2,300
总计 73,600

总预算为73,600元人民币。这个预算涵盖了网站搭建的主要成本,但也应根据实际情况进行调整。例如,如果网站功能更复杂,开发成本可能会增加;如果选择使用现成模板,设计和开发成本可能会降低。

7. 预算控制与优化

在制定预算后,还需要采取以下措施进行控制与优化:

  • 明确优先级:根据网站目标和业务需求,确定功能优先级,优先开发核心功能。
  • 选择合适的技术方案:避免过度设计,选择成熟稳定的技术方案,以降低开发成本。
  • 利用开源资源:如使用WordPress等开源CMS系统,可以节省设计和开发成本。
  • 分阶段开发:将网站开发分为多个阶段,逐步投入资金,以降低风险。
  • 定期评估:定期评估项目进度和成本,及时调整预算和计划。

常见问题与排查

在网站搭建过程中,可能会遇到各种问题。以下是一些常见问题及其排查方法:

1. 预算超支

预算超支是网站搭建中常见的问题。以下是一些导致预算超支的原因及解决方法:

  • 需求变更:在开发过程中增加新的功能或修改现有功能,导致开发工作量增加。
  • 技术难度:遇到未预见的技術难题,需要投入更多时间和资源解决。
  • 沟通不畅:开发团队与客户之间的沟通不畅,导致误解和返工。
  • 资源不足:开发团队资源不足,导致项目延期和成本增加。

解决方法:

  • 严格控制需求变更:在项目开始前明确需求,并在开发过程中严格控制变更。
  • 选择合适的技术方案:避免使用过于复杂或不成熟的技术,以降低技术风险。
  • 加强沟通:建立有效的沟通机制,确保开发团队与客户之间的信息同步。
  • 合理分配资源:确保开发团队有足够的人力资源,以按时完成项目。

2. 项目延期

项目延期不仅会影响预算,还会影响网站上线时间。以下是一些导致项目延期的原因及解决方法:

  • 需求不明确:在项目开始前需求不明确,导致开发过程中频繁变更。
  • 技术难题:遇到未预见的技術难题,需要投入更多时间和资源解决。
  • 资源不足:开发团队资源不足,导致项目进度缓慢。
  • 沟通不畅:开发团队与客户之间的沟通不畅,导致误解和返工。

解决方法:

  • 明确需求:在项目开始前明确需求,并在开发过程中严格控制变更。
  • 选择合适的技术方案:避免使用过于复杂或不成熟的技术,以降低技术风险。
  • 合理分配资源:确保开发团队有足够的人力资源,以按时完成项目。
  • 加强沟通:建立有效的沟通机制,确保开发团队与客户之间的信息同步。

3. 网站性能问题

网站性能问题会影响用户体验和SEO排名。以下是一些常见的网站性能问题及解决方法:

  • 加载速度慢:优化图片大小、使用CDN、减少HTTP请求等。
  • 服务器响应慢:升级服务器配置、优化数据库、使用缓存等。
  • 资源冲突:JavaScript或CSS文件冲突,导致页面显示异常。

解决方法:

  • 优化图片:使用压缩工具减小图片大小,使用适当的图片格式(如WebP)。
  • 使用CDN:使用CDN加速内容分发,提高网站加载速度。
  • 减少HTTP请求:合并CSS和JavaScript文件,减少页面加载时间。
  • 升级服务器:根据网站流量需求,选择合适的服务器配置。
  • 优化数据库:定期清理数据库,优化查询语句。
  • 使用缓存:使用浏览器缓存和服务器缓存,提高网站响应速度。
  • 解决资源冲突:检查JavaScript和CSS文件,确保没有冲突。

4. 网站安全问题

网站安全问题会影响用户数据和网站正常运行。以下是一些常见的网站安全问题及解决方法:

  • SQL注入:使用参数化查询,避免直接拼接SQL语句。
  • 跨站脚本攻击(XSS):对用户输入进行过滤和转义,避免恶意脚本执行。
  • 文件上传漏洞:限制文件上传类型,对上传文件进行扫描和验证。
  • 弱密码:要求用户使用强密码,定期更换密码。

解决方法:

  • 使用安全框架:使用成熟的安全框架,如OWASP Top 10防范常见安全漏洞。
  • 定期更新:及时更新CMS系统、插件和主题,修复已知漏洞。
  • 使用防火墙:使用Web应用防火墙(WAF),防止恶意攻击。
  • 数据备份:定期备份网站数据,以便在发生安全事件时恢复数据。

总结

制定网站搭建预算是一个复杂的过程,需要综合考虑多个因素。通过明确需求、细化功能、估算成本、控制风险和优化方案,可以制定出既符合预期又具有成本效益的网站搭建预算。在项目实施过程中,还需要密切关注项目进度和成本,及时调整计划,以确保项目顺利完成。

希望本文提供的实践指南能够帮助您更好地制定网站搭建预算,并成功构建出满足需求的网站。